From 1ad6125580dfb48c9625766be929eabfa43c7b73 Mon Sep 17 00:00:00 2001 From: Rust Maintainers Date: Sun, 15 Oct 2017 20:31:03 +0100 Subject: [PATCH] u-ignoretest-ppc64el Gbp-Pq: Name u-ignoretest-ppc64el.patch --- src/libarena/lib.rs | 3 +++ src/libstd/thread/local.rs | 6 +++---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/src/libarena/lib.rs b/src/libarena/lib.rs index 4338ac7fd0..51a9421bec 100644 --- a/src/libarena/lib.rs +++ b/src/libarena/lib.rs @@ -576,6 +576,9 @@ mod tests { #[test] fn test_typed_arena_drop_small_count() { + if cfg!(target_arch = "powerpc64") { + return; + } DROP_COUNTER.with(|c| c.set(0)); { let arena: TypedArena = TypedArena::new(); diff --git a/src/libstd/thread/local.rs b/src/libstd/thread/local.rs index c2c6e6cf87..61556d1a71 100644 --- a/src/libstd/thread/local.rs +++ b/src/libstd/thread/local.rs @@ -410,7 +410,7 @@ pub mod os { #[cfg(all(test, not(target_os = "emscripten")))] mod tests { use sync::mpsc::{channel, Sender}; - use cell::{Cell, UnsafeCell}; + use cell::UnsafeCell; use super::LocalKeyState; use thread; @@ -423,9 +423,9 @@ mod tests { } } - #[test] + #[test] #[cfg(not(target_arch = "powerpc64"))] fn smoke_no_dtor() { - thread_local!(static FOO: Cell = Cell::new(1)); + thread_local!(static FOO: ::cell::Cell = ::cell::Cell::new(1)); FOO.with(|f| { assert_eq!(f.get(), 1); -- 2.30.2